With home advantage, Chelsea started the game with great determination and had a chance to open the scoring in the 7th minute after Gallagher's shot from outside the penalty area. However, coach Mauricio Pochettino's team was denied a goal by the crossbar.

Having a good game, Chelsea made a personal mistake in the 16th minute, allowing Callum Wilson to dribble from midfield into the penalty area and score the opening goal for the Magpies.
This goal caused Chelsea a lot of trouble in the following period, when Newcastle actively played with a low formation. The Blues could not find an equalizer in the first 45 minutes.
In the second half, coach Mauricio Pochettino directed his players to attack at a higher speed. The Argentine coach also made 5 substitutions to increase the pressure. Notably, he brought Mykhailo Mudryk onto the field in the 78th minute.

Mykhailo Mudryk was Chelsea's hero when he scored the equalizer 1-1 in the 90+2 minute. In this situation, the Ukrainian player rushed into the penalty area to finish very quickly after the away team's defender controlled the ball incorrectly.
After a 1-1 draw after regulation time, Chelsea and Newcastle had to go into a penalty shootout to decide the winner. In the shootout, Chelsea won 4-2 to book their place in the semi-finals of the 2023/2024 League Cup.

In the remaining two quarter-final matches taking place on the morning of December 20, Fulham drew 1-1 with Everton and won the penalty shootout 7-6. Meanwhile, Middlesbrough easily beat Port Vale to secure a ticket to the next round.
